What is a program manager contract?

A Program Manager Contract job is a temporary or fixed-term role where a professional oversees multiple related projects, ensuring alignment with business goals. These managers coordinate teams, manage budgets, mitigate risks, and drive project execution within a specified timeframe. Unlike full-time roles, contract positions typically focus on delivering specific outcomes within a limited duration. Program Manager Contractors may work for a company directly or through a consulting firm. Their expertise is critical in implementing strategic initiatives efficiently.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a program manager contract?

To thrive as a Program Manager Contract, you need strong project management abilities, expertise in contract negotiation, and a relevant degree or equivalent experience in business or a related field. Familiarity with project management software (such as MS Project or Asana), contract management systems, and certifications like PMP or Contract Management Certification are often preferred. Excellent communication, problem-solving, and stakeholder management skills are essential soft skills for this role. These competencies ensure smooth program delivery, compliance with contractual obligations, and effective collaboration with cross-functional teams.

We are seeking a highly strategic, numbers-drivenMaterial Program Manager (MPM) – PCBAto orchestrate the end-to-end material architecture for our printed circuit board assemblies. This role requiresa8+ year veteran who will split focus evenly between launching fast-paced New Product Introductions (NPI) and scaling long-term Mass Production.

Key ResponsibilitiesNPI Material Readiness & Engineering Collaboration
  • Early Lifecycle Risk Scrubbing:Partner with Hardware Engineering during early design phases. Scrub Bill of Materials (BOMs) usingZ2Datato flag cross-references, obsolescence risks, and compliance flags before design freeze.
  • Prototyping Sourcing Strategy:Manage rapid-turn prototype material procurement. Secure component allocations for initial engineering validation builds (EVT/DVT/PVT).
  • Transition Governance:Standardize and own the data handoff process as PCBAs transition from engineering prototypes into stable mass production.
Mass Production Component Planning & Execution
  • Clear-to-Build (CTB) Management:Maintain rigorous, real-time CTB line visibility. Resolve component shortages before they impact production schedules at our EMS providers.
  • Demand & Forecast Alignment:Translate rolling production forecasts into actionable component-level plans. Align capacity commitments with Tier-1 chipmakers and distributors.
  • Resiliency Management:Constantly monitor market supply health usingZ2Data. Track lead times, geo-political risks, and structural component allocations to formulate mitigation strategies.
Strategic EMS & Vendor Governance
  • Material Liability Control:Monitor Contract Manufacturer inventory levels, excess and obsolete (E&O) exposure, and manufacturing component yields.
  • Shortage Escalation:Drive emergency vendor escalations for high-impact shortages. Secure factory allocations and negotiate expedited delivery dates.
